KABUL, AFGHANISTAN -MARCH 29, 2016:  At the Emergency hospital a Pashtun boy waits for an X-ray on his leg from a mine injury in Kabul on March 29, 2016. Every year the UN comes out with their report documenting the unfortunate carnage from America’s longest and most costly war in history. Along with the price tag estimated in the hundreds of billions, the human toll from a 2015 UN Assistance Mission To Afghanistan (UNAMA) report stated the number of Afghan civilians killed and wounded surpassed 11,000.  which was the deadliest on record for civilians in Afghanistan since the US-led invasion more than 14 years ago.
